But here's my take on things...

Let's say that the Excelsior project was a project that was a long time in development (like the original Connie).  It could've started off as a testbed for new technologies in TOS times, and had multiple problems like underpowered nacelles (the technology not being in place yet for TMP and the higher powered TMP engines) structural reinforcement problems (a lot larger ship than even a Star Empire), and a good number of other problems that weren't resolved by the end of TOS.  At this time, it'd have recieved and kept NX-2000.

However, with the refit of the Enterprise, new tech was available.  A relook would've been done with the new tech available to refit and finally get the Excelsior flying and out of mothballs.  The warp engines would've been totally rebuilt to provide more power for the huge ship, the hull totally rebuilt, and few systems would've been left.  And then the transwarp engine project came up.  Another hull reinforcement, and upgrading of the SIF generators to try and handle the stresses of transwarp.  And then transwarp failure.  Going back to the rebuilt non-transwarp engine design with all the new SIF changes and other transwarp reinforcements remaining in place.  And there we go.
